Ingredients
Scale
- 1 lb fresh shrimp, raw, peeled, and deveined
- 1 cup cocktail sauce (mix of ½ cup ketchup, 2 tbsp horseradish, 1 tbsp lemon juice, and 1 tsp Worcestershire sauce)
- 2 lemon wedges
- Fresh herbs (parsley or dill) for garnish
- Ice for serving
Instructions
- Fill a large serving platter with ice.
- In a large pot of boiling salted water, cook the shrimp for 2-3 minutes until they turn pink. Avoid overcooking.
- Transfer the cooked shrimp to an ice bath for about 3-5 minutes to cool completely.
- While the shrimp cools, mix the cocktail sauce ingredients in a bowl and adjust seasoning as desired.
- Arrange the chilled shrimp on the ice bed, serve with lemon wedges, and drizzle with cocktail sauce.
- Prep Time: 15 minutes
- Cook Time: 5 minutes
